This title will be available to order on 4/15/2026. Beneath ocean waves there exists a fascinating and vital ecosystem. Underwater meadows, teaming with vibrant life, sway and ripple in the currents. Welcome to the wonders of seagrass. These underwater flowering plants evolved from land plants millions of years ago. Often called "the lungs of the sea," seagrass meadows are found on every continent except Antarctica. Within this ecosystem is an abundance of marine life, including many species of fish, mammals, reptiles, and invertebrates. And beyond providing shelter and food for these inhabitants and visitors, seagrass plays an important role in the health of our planet. Seagrass lessens the effects of climate change and even helps filter out plastics and pollutants awash in the ocean. But this important ecosystem is under threat from many human activities. It's time to pay attention to this vital space on Earth. Through lyrical text and ethereal artwork, the wonders of the aweinspiring world of seagrass comes to life for young readers. Back matter includes information about the diverse species making their homes in seagrass, along with a glossary of terms.
